- W2079146105 abstract "Analysis of the first and second order statistical properties of light is a powerful means of establishing the properties of amedium with which the light has interacted. In turn, the first and second order statistical properties of the medium dictatethe manner in which light interacts with the medium. The former is the inverse problem and the latter is the forwardproblem. Towards an understanding of the propagation of light through complex structures, such as biological tissue, onemight choose to explore either the inverse or the forward problem. Fundamental to the problem, however, is a physicalparametric model that relates the two halves; a model that allows prediction of the measured effect or prediction of theparameters based on measurements. This is the objective of our study. As a means of characterizing the first and secondorder properties of tissue, we discuss measurements with differential interference contrast microscopy using a phasesteppingapproach. First and second order properties are characterized respectively in terms of scatter phase functionsand spatial power spectral densities. Results are shown for representative tissue." @default.
